- Is your Internet experience slowing down?
- Maybe you need to clear out your browser's temporary
Internet files or "cache"?
The following are directions on clearing out Internet
Explorer 6.0 (IE) temporary files.
First, select "tools" off IE's main menu. Next,
select "Internet Options" off the tools menu.
Below is an image of the drop down tools menu with "Internet
Options" selected.

Selecting "Internet Options" will cause a dialog
of the same name to be display. Below is an image of
the "Internet Options" dialog.
.
The "General" tab of the options dialog should
be showing. If not, please select it.
Notice the middle section of the General tab. Your will
see the "Temporary Internet files" section. Notice
the "Delete files" button. Clicking on this button
will delete all the temporary files that IE has stored.
This will greatly enhance your browsing experience

If your browser still seems to be sluggish1,
select the "Delete Cookies" button2
on the above tab.
These two suggestions should speed up your browser

2Be
aware that removing your "cookies" may cause you to
have to re-enter user names and passwords that you may
have previously saved within a "cookie". You
will just need to re-enter your user name and password
to access these sites once more.
